The SMART App Launch Framework connects third-party applications to Electronic Health Record data, allowing apps to launch from inside or outside the user interface of an EHR system. Substitutable Medical Applications and Reusable Technologies (SMART on FHIR®) is a healthcare standard through which applications can access clinical information through a data store. SMART-on-FHIR Overview SMART authorization is an OAuth2 profile that extends authorization with service discovery, launch context and scopes.
